Hi Demol,
As Recap pointed on the Eiusdemmodi site, the problem is the cable you're using.
Most VGA-SCART cables you'll find on the internet are worthless for our purposes because they're designed to output from SCART to VGA, instead of from VGA to SCART that's what you want.
